首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Tensorflow对象检测API:打印检测到的类作为输出

TensorFlow对象检测API是一种基于TensorFlow框架的机器学习工具,用于实现目标检测任务。它可以识别和定位图像或视频中的特定对象,并将检测到的类别打印作为输出。

TensorFlow对象检测API的主要优势包括:

  1. 准确性:TensorFlow对象检测API使用先进的深度学习算法,具有较高的检测准确性和精度。
  2. 可扩展性:该API支持在不同规模的数据集上进行训练和推理,可以适应各种应用场景。
  3. 灵活性:TensorFlow对象检测API提供了丰富的预训练模型和网络架构,可以根据需求选择合适的模型进行目标检测。
  4. 高效性:该API经过优化,可以在多种硬件设备上高效运行,包括CPU、GPU和TPU等。

TensorFlow对象检测API适用于许多应用场景,包括但不限于:

  1. 物体识别和定位:可以用于自动驾驶、智能监控、工业质检等领域,实现对特定物体的识别和定位。
  2. 人脸识别:可以用于人脸识别系统,实现人脸检测、人脸关键点定位、人脸属性分析等功能。
  3. 物体计数:可以用于商场人流统计、交通流量监测等场景,实现对特定物体数量的统计。
  4. 图像分割:可以用于医学图像分析、图像编辑等领域,实现对图像中不同区域的分割。

腾讯云提供了一系列与TensorFlow对象检测API相关的产品和服务,包括:

  1. 腾讯云AI机器学习平台(https://cloud.tencent.com/product/tiia):提供了基于TensorFlow的图像识别、人脸识别等API服务。
  2. 腾讯云图像处理(https://cloud.tencent.com/product/imagerecognition):提供了图像识别、图像分割等功能,可与TensorFlow对象检测API结合使用。
  3. 腾讯云视频处理(https://cloud.tencent.com/product/vod):提供了视频内容识别、视频分析等功能,可用于处理包含目标检测的视频数据。

通过使用腾讯云的相关产品和服务,结合TensorFlow对象检测API,开发者可以快速构建和部署各种目标检测应用,并实现高效、准确的目标检测功能。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

训练Tensorflow对象检测API能够告诉你答案

背景:最近我们看到了一篇文章,关于如何用于你自己数据集,训练Tensorflow对象检测API。这篇文章让我们对对象检测产生了关注,正巧圣诞节来临,我们打算用这种方法试着找到圣诞老人。...创建Tensorflow记录文件 一旦边界框信息存储在一个csv文件中,下一步就是将csv文件和图像转换为一个TF记录文件,这是Tensorflow对象检测API使用文件格式。...对于我们实例,它只是一个。 item { id: 1 Name: santa } 创建配置文件 对于训练,我们使用faster_rcnn_inception_resnet配置文件作为基础。...为了导出模型,我们选择了从训练工作中获得最新检查点,并将其输出到一个冻结推理图中。...我们希望你现在能够为你自己数据集训练对象检测器。

1.4K80

简易版物体识别

这是一个帮助我们实现对象检测算法作为解决方案工具解决方案。...通过简单调用神经网络额模型并将图片作为输入可以使你编码 变得更容易。最终,你可以在工作目录下得到输出结果。...这有一个简单函数可以打印出名字和通过网络预测得到概率。 ? 在这种情况下,我们引用了三个输出项,输出图像,检测到对象名称及其概率百分比。我们有图像,这里是proba百分比。...66.24709963798523 car : 52.94407606124878 bicycle : 91.05990529060364 person : 86.73182129859924 不一定按顺序给出,我们模型已成功检测到作为前景中的人...如果你还没有对此做出响应,可以阅读这篇文章,它提供了有关如何使用对象检测七个有趣想法。记住,不要局限于这些想法!

1K10
  • ShapeShifter: Robust Physical Adversarial Attack on Faster R-CNN Object Detector

    作为一个案例研究,我们生成了一些反向干扰停止信号,这些信号可以被更快R-CNN作为实际驱动测试中目标对象持续错误地检测到。我们贡献概述如下。...4.2、扩展到攻击Faster R-CNN一个目标检测器 采用一个图像作为输入,并且输出N个检测目标。每个检测包含一个预先定义K分布和检测到目标位置,用4个坐标表示。...请注意,根据输入图像,对象检测器可以输出更多或更少检测目标,但是为了简单起见,我们选择按置信度排序前n个检测目标。如第2.2节所述,Faster R-CNN采用两阶段方法。...低于30%置信值被认为未被检测到;我们决定使用30%阈值,而不是Tensorflow目标检测API中默认50%,来对我们自己(“攻击者”)施加更严格要求。...例如,我们实现了目标成功率87%,误导目标探测器探测停车标志作为一个人,以及更高诸多成功率93%当我们攻击目标是使检测器未能检测到停车标志(如15 ' 0◦)或检测不是一个停车标志。

    1.7K50

    使用Tensorflow对象检测在安卓手机上“寻找”皮卡丘

    TensorFlow许多功能和工具中,隐藏着一个名为TensorFlow对象探测APITensorFlow Object Detection API组件。...TensorFlow对象检测API:https://github.com/tensorflow/models/tree/master/research/object_detection ?...在应用中检测屏幕截图 Tensorflow对象检测API 这个程序包是TensorFlow对象检测问题响应——也就是说,在一个框架中检测实际对象(皮卡丘)过程。...如果一切顺利的话,应用启动,找到你对象一些图片,看看这个模型是否能够检测到它们。以下是我在手机上做一些检测: ? 穿着和服皮卡丘 ? 几个皮卡丘。...其中大部分没有被检测到 总结和回顾 在本文中,我解释了使用TensorFlow对象检测库来训练自定义模型所有必要步骤。

    2.1K50

    使用Python中ImageAI进行对象检测

    ImageAI利用了几种脱机工作API-它具有对象检测,视频检测对象跟踪API,无需访问互联网即可调用它们。ImageAI利用了预先训练模型,可以轻松地进行定制。...对于本教程,我们需要以下文件夹: 对象检测:根文件夹 模型:存储预先训练模型 输入:存储要在其上执行对象检测图像文件 输出:存储带有检测到对象图像文件 创建文件夹后,Object detection...input_image是我们正在检测图像所在路径,而output_image_path参数是将图像与检测到对象一起存储路径。...此函数返回一个字典,其中包含图像中检测到所有对象名称和百分比概率。...,您可以看到每个检测到对象名称及其百分比概率,如下所示: 输出 car : 54.72719073295593car : 58.94589424133301car : 62.59384751319885car

    2.5K11

    教程 | 教Alexa看懂手语,不说话也能控制语音助手

    然而,在馈入 kNN 之前,图像首先通过名为 SqueezeNet 小型神经网络。然后,将该网络倒数第二层输出馈入 kNN,这样就可以训练自己了。...然后,我使用网页端 API 进行语音合成,用以说出检测到标签。 5. 如果说出单词是 'Alexa',它会唤醒附近 Echo 并开始监听指令。...确保不会检测到任何符号,除非已经说过唤醒词 Alexa。 2. 添加一个完整全部类别的训练集,我将空闲状态归类为「其他」(空背景,我懒散地垂着手臂站着等等)。这可以防止误单词。 3....在接受输出之前设置高阈值以减少预测错误。 4. 降低预测率。不要以最大帧速率进行预测,控制每秒预测量有助于减少错误预测。 5. 确保已在该短语中检测到单词不再用于预测。 6....,那么通过将「weather」标记为终端词,可以在检测到该词时正确地触发转录。虽然很有效,但这意味着用户必须在训练期间将单词标记为终端,并且假设这个单词仅出现在查询指令结尾。

    2.4K20

    校园视频AI分析识别算法 TensorFlow

    校园视频AI分析识别算法通过分布式TensorFlow模型训练,校园视频AI分析识别算法对学生行为进行实时监测,当系统检测到学生出现打架、翻墙、倒地、抽烟等异常行为时算法将自动发出警报提示。...TF生成会话时候,可愿意通过设置tf.log_device_placemaent参数来打印每一个运算设备。...目前采用TensorFlow平台作为模型训练受选择,在生产环境下进行深度学习公司有ARM、Google、UBER、DeepMind、京东等公司。...校园视频AI分析识别算法训练过程中TensorFlow主要特性有:使用灵活:TensorFlow是一个灵活神经网络学习平台,采用图计算模型,支持High-LevelAPI,支持Python、C++、...Session()调用sessrun()方法来执行图result = sess. run(product)//product是op计算输出.result是一个numpy对象//'run(product

    26710

    ImageAI:专为没有机器学习背景程序员设计,让你十行代码搞定对象检测

    ,在第二行中将模型类型设置为RetinaNet,第三行中将模型路径设置为RetinaNet模型路径,第四行中将模型加载到对象检测,然后在第五行调用检测函数并解析输入图像路径和输出图像路径。...,然后在第二行中打印出在图像中检测到每个对象上模型名称和概率百分比。...ImageAI支持许多强大对象检测过程定制。比如能够提取图像中检测到每个物体图像。...– 自定义对象检测:使用我们提供CustomObject,可以使检测报告一个或几个特定对象检测结果。...– 输入类型:你可以指定并解析图像文件路径、Numpy数组或图像文件流作为输入图像 – 输出类型:你可以指定detectObjectsFromImage函数应该以文件或Numpy数组形式返回图像

    92240

    使用 YOLO 进行对象检测:保姆级动手教程

    顾名思义,一次“查看”就足以找到图像上所有对象并识别它们。 在机器学习术语中,我们可以说所有对象都是通过一次算法运行检测到。...YOLO 作为 TensorFlow 和 Keras 中物体检测器 机器学习中 TensorFlow 和 Keras 框架 框架在每个信息技术领域都是必不可少。机器学习也不例外。...我们获取每个检测到对象名、框大小和坐标: predict() 方法中有多个参数,让我们指定是否要使用预测边界框、每个对象文本名称等绘制图像。...要了解预训练 YOLO 模型能够检测到哪些对象类型,请查看 .../yolo-v4-tf.kers/class_names/ 中 coco_classes.txt 文件。...回顾一下,模型所做检测以一种方便 Pandas DataFrame 形式返回。我们获取每个检测到对象名、框大小和坐标。

    5.1K10

    【业界】Facebook发布开源“Detectron”深度学习库,用于对象检测

    几个星期后,谷歌发布了此版本Tensorflow图像识别API。两个库都实现了最新深度学习算法,用于对象检测。 ?...谷歌Tensorflow图像识别API于2017年6月首次发布,是近40个不同深度学习项目中更大型Tensorflow研究库一部分。...目标检测仍然是计算机视觉领域一个具有挑战性分支,但在计算机视觉领域中许多方面都有应用,从数码相机简单人脸检测到图像检索和视频监控。...基于R-CNN算法通过使用多种不同大小滑动窗口来处理各种尺寸检测对象对象检测算法YOLO(只看一次)算法在图像上应用一次性网格,并使用不同特征提取和决策架构。...这个重要创新被称为实例分割,并且将每个像素归类为归属或不归属于推断对象。 调查表明,TensorFlow对象检测API更容易用于训练专有模型。

    75640

    如何用10行代码完成目标检测

    像其他计算机技术一样,对象检测广泛创造性和惊人用途肯定会来自计算机程序员和软件开发人员努力。 在应用程序和系统中使用现代对象检测方法,并基于这些方法构建新应用程序不是一项简单任务。...一旦结果打印到控制台中,转到您FirstDetection.py所在文件夹,您将发现保存了一个新图像。看看下面的两个图像样本和检测后保存新图像。 检测前: ? 检测后: ?...数据结果 我们可以看到程序会打印输出一些各个物体概率数据: person : 55.8402955532074 person : 53.21805477142334 person : 69.25139427185059...,将模型类型设置为RetinaNet在第二行,设置模型路径路径在第三行RetinaNet模型,该模型加载到对象检测在第四行,然后我们称为检测函数,解析输入图像路径和输出图像路径在第五行。...,然后在第二行打印出图像中检测到每个对象模型名称和百分比概率。

    65430

    独家 | 在浏览器中使用TensorFlow.js和Python构建机器学习模型(附代码)

    谷歌预训练模型:TensorFlow.js配备了一套由谷歌预训练模型,用于对象检测、图像分割、语音识别、文本毒性分类等任务。...我们在控制台得到上述操作输出: ? 如果你想深入阅读有关Core API更多信息,那么我建议你阅读CoreAPI官方文档。...该算法只是简单地估计关键身体关节位置。 检测到关键点设置为“Part”和“ID”索引,置信度得分在0.0和1.0之间(1.0是最高)。 ? 以下是PoseNet给出输出类型示例: ?...'score'是指模型置信度 'part'表示检测到身体关节/关键点 'position'包含检测到部分x和y位置 我们不必为此部分编写代码,因为它是自动生成。...步骤3:显示检测到的人体关节 我们知道被检测到的人体关节及其x和y位置。现在,我们只需要在视频上画出它们来显示检测到的人体关节。

    1.6K20

    在浏览器中使用TensorFlow.js和Python构建机器学习模型(附代码)

    谷歌预训练模型:TensorFlow.js配备了一套由谷歌预训练模型,用于对象检测、图像分割、语音识别、文本毒性分类等任务。...我们在控制台得到上述操作输出: ? 如果你想深入阅读有关Core API更多信息,那么我建议你阅读CoreAPI官方文档。...该算法只是简单地估计关键身体关节位置。 检测到关键点设置为“Part”和“ID”索引,置信度得分在0.0和1.0之间(1.0是最高)。 ? 以下是PoseNet给出输出类型示例: ?...'score'是指模型置信度 'part'表示检测到身体关节/关键点 'position'包含检测到部分x和y位置 我们不必为此部分编写代码,因为它是自动生成。...步骤3:显示检测到的人体关节 我们知道被检测到的人体关节及其x和y位置。现在,我们只需要在视频上画出它们来显示检测到的人体关节。

    2.2K00

    只需连接电脑摄像头,就能用深度学习进行实时对象检测

    Tensorflow 对象检测模型 你可以在 tensorflow 库中轻松找到上述神经网络架构预训练模型。它们统称为 tensorflow 检测模型集合。...任何检测到对象都将通过可视化模块,在图像中检测到对象周围放置彩色边界框。 我们还添加了一个跟踪模块,用于显示房间是否为空以及房间内的人数。这些数据将被存储在单独.csv 文件中。...一旦我们得到 tensorflow 预测结果,这些预测/检测值将被插入到输出队列中,然后通过 object_tracker 可视化模块,最后我们将处理后帧写入单独文件并将结果显示给用户。...我们将利用 Python 中多线程来提高处理视频帧速度。 下面的 worker 函数将从输入队列中获取帧数据,加载 tensorflow 模型并将任何检测结果传回输出队列。...这是与主线程分开运行。 ? 当然,为了可视化检测,我们需要传递检测到标签,它们各自置信度,边界框颜色和坐标,并将它们绘制到帧图像上。 ?

    1.2K20

    10行代码实现目标检测,请收下这份教程

    ,第二行将模型类型设置为 RetinaNet,并在第三行将模型路径设置为 RetinaNet 模型路径,第四行将模型加载到目标检测,第五行调用目标检测函数,解析输入输出图像路径。...eachObject["percentage_probability"] ) 在上面的2行代码中,第一行迭代执行 detector.detectObjectsFromImage 函数并返回所有的结果,然后在第二行打印出所检测到每个目标的名称及其概率值...ImageAI 支持许多强大目标检测过程。其中之一就是能够提取图像中检测到每个目标。...你可以增加高确定性目标的检测概率,或者在需要检测所有可能对象情况下降低该概率值。...Custom Objects Detection:使用所提供 CustomObject ,如此检测函数将打印出一个或几个唯一目标的检测结果。

    74810

    10行代码实现目标检测,请收下这份教程

    ,第二行将模型类型设置为 RetinaNet,并在第三行将模型路径设置为 RetinaNet 模型路径,第四行将模型加载到目标检测,第五行调用目标检测函数,解析输入输出图像路径。...eachObject["percentage_probability"] ) 在上面的2行代码中,第一行迭代执行 detector.detectObjectsFromImage 函数并返回所有的结果,然后在第二行打印出所检测到每个目标的名称及其概率值...ImageAI 支持许多强大目标检测过程。其中之一就是能够提取图像中检测到每个目标。...你可以增加高确定性目标的检测概率,或者在需要检测所有可能对象情况下降低该概率值。...Custom Objects Detection:使用所提供 CustomObject ,如此检测函数将打印出一个或几个唯一目标的检测结果。

    71310

    深度学习框架TensorFlow 官方文档中文版

    源 op 输出被传递给其它 op 做运算. Python 库中, op 构造器返回值代表被构造出 op 输出, 这些返回值可以传递给其它 op 构造器作为输入....启动图第一步是创建一个 Session 对象, 如果无任何创建参数, 会话构造器将启动默认图. 欲了解完整会话 API, 请阅读Session . ?...一般你不需要显式指定使用 CPU 还是 GPU, TensorFlow 能自动检测. 如果检测到 GPU, TensorFlow 会尽可能地利用找到第一个 GPU 来执行操作....Fetch 为了取回操作输出内容, 可以在使用 Session 对象 run() 调用 执行图时, 传入一些 tensor, 这些 tensor 会帮助你取回结果....TensorFlow 还提供了 feed 机制, 该机制 可以临时替代图中任意操作中 tensor 可以对图中任何操作提交补丁, 直接插入一个 tensor. feed 使用一个 tensor 值临时替换一个操作输出结果

    96530

    【干货】手把手教你用苹果Core ML和Swift开发人脸目标识别APP

    TensorFlow对象目标检测API demo可以让您识别图像中目标的位置,这可以应用到一些很酷应用程序中。 有时我们可能会拍摄更多人物照片而不是景物照片,所以可以用同样技术来识别人脸。...对象检测API是基于TensorFlow构建框架,用于在图像中识别对象。...例如,你可以用许多猫照片来训练对象检测器,一旦训练好了你就可以输入一个待遇测图像,它会返回一个矩形列表,每个矩形中有一个猫。虽然是API,但您可以把它看作是一组用于迁移学习方便实用工具。...由于对象检测API(Object Detection API)会输出对象在图像中位置,因此不能将图像和标签作为训练数据传递给对象。...最后,在我iOS应用程序中,可以监听图像Firestore路径更新。如果检测到,我会下载图像,并与检测分数一起显示在应用程序中。这个函数将替换上面第一个Swift代码片段中注释: ?

    14.8K60
    领券